"In a memo to staff, chairman David Bradley wrote that even though they have had exceptional growth in print and digital subscriptions since September, when they introduced a paywall, there has been an overnight and and near-complete undoing of in-person events and, for now, a bracing decline in advertising. The cuts represent 17% of staff.
Bradley also announced play cuts for executives and a general pay freeze for the rest of the year. He wrote, I was to tell our departing colleagues how deeply sorry I am. If we saw any prospect that your jobs souls return in a reset Atlantic, we would have found another way forward.
(snip)
"The Atlantic is only the latest publication to announce layoffs amid the coronavirus crisis, which in some cases only made problems with softening revenue streams worse. Vox Media, BuzzFeed and The Hollywood Reporter also have made staff cuts."
